Meaning
Relatives by marriage, brothers-in-law or sisters-in-law.
Good to know
plural of shemeji (ji-/ma- class, human referent); wa- agreement.
Examples
- Mashemeji wangu walikuja harusini.My in-laws came to the wedding.
- Je, mashemeji hao wanaishi mjini?Do those in-laws live in town?
- Mashemeji hawakukubaliana juu ya zawadi.The in-laws did not agree on the gift.
- Tutawakaribisha mashemeji wengine sikukuu ijayo.We will welcome more in-laws for the next holiday.
